Purnell, Baltimore, MD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Purnell?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Purnell Studio Apartments | $988 | $950 | $1,026 |
Purnell 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,260 | $895 | $1,510 |
Purnell 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,408 | $950 | $1,800 |
Purnell 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,824 | $1,275 | $2,209 |

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
